Telescopic water fed poles are specially designed tools that allow users to clean windows from the ground without the need for ladders. By combining telescopic technology with a water distribution system, these poles facilitate deep cleaning, providing a streak-free finish while reaching heights that would typically require scaffolding or ladders. Their popularity can be attributed to their practicality, safety, and ease of use.

Quality of Material: The materials used in the construction of a telescopic pole play a pivotal role in its overall performance. Buyers should look for poles made of lightweight, yet durable materials such as carbon fiber or aluminum. Carbon fiber poles, though more expensive, offer superior strength and rigidity, making them ideal for high-frequency use. Aluminum poles, while generally heavier, can still provide excellent value for residential cleaners.
Length and Reach: One of the primary advantages of telescopic water fed poles is their extendable nature. Buyers should assess their specific cleaning requirements to determine the appropriate length. Typically, poles can extend anywhere from 20 to 60 feet, with some high-end models reaching even greater lengths. For professionals dealing with multi-story buildings, investing in a pole with extended reach is essential.
Water Distribution System: The effectiveness of a water fed pole heavily relies on its water delivery mechanism. Look for poles that come with built-in hoses for efficient water flow, as well as high-quality brushes designed to ensure thorough cleaning. Many poles feature adjustable water flow settings, enabling users to customize the amount of water dispensed based on the job's requirements.
Brush Type: The type of brush attached to the water fed pole can influence the effectiveness of the cleaning process. Soft bristle brushes are suitable for delicate glass surfaces, while stiffer bristles can be employed for tougher jobs with more stubborn residues. Some models offer interchangeable brushes, allowing users to optimize their cleaning approach based on the surface type.
Ease of Use: Consider how user-friendly each pole is in terms of its weight, maneuverability, and locking mechanism. The best telescopic poles will be easy to extend and retract, allowing for quick adjustments while cleaning at height. A good grip is also essential for ensuring the operator's safety and comfort during long cleaning sessions.
